How to Design Solar PV System

Solar photovoltaic system or Solar power system is one of renewable energy system which uses PV modules to convert sunlight into electricity. The electricity generated can be either stored or used directly, fed back into grid line or combined with one or more other electricity generators or more renewable energy source.

Solar plant design guide: the basics

Utility-scale solar plants, also known as solar farms or solar power plants, are large-scale solar energy installations designed to generate electricity on a utility or grid scale. These solar facilities are typically developed and owned by utility companies, independent power producers (IPPs), or renewable energy developers.

"Dragon scale" solar panels chosen for new space station …

Albuquerque, New Mexico-based mPower Technology announced its DragonSCALE solar power system has been chosen by Gravitics to power its space station units. Gravitics is currently developing StarMax, a flexible-use space station module that provides up to 400 cubic meters of habitable space.
